What your labs are actually telling you
Before we talk about food, it helps to understand what you're trying to move and why.
Elevated A1c
A1c reflects your average blood sugar over the past two to three months. When it's elevated — above 5.7% for prediabetes, above 6.5% for diabetes — it means your body is struggling to manage glucose efficiently.
The foods that matter most here are carbohydrates, because carbohydrates break down into glucose. But the story is more nuanced than "eat fewer carbs." The type of carbohydrate matters enormously. Fiber-rich carbohydrates — beans, lentils, whole grains, most vegetables — are digested slowly and produce a gradual glucose response. Refined carbohydrates — white bread, white rice, most crackers and cereals — spike blood sugar fast.
Protein and fat also matter. Including protein and healthy fat at each meal slows gastric emptying, which blunts the glucose spike from whatever carbohydrates you eat alongside them.
High LDL cholesterol
LDL ("bad") cholesterol is primarily driven by dietary saturated fat and, to a lesser extent, dietary cholesterol. Saturated fat is concentrated in red meat, full-fat dairy, butter, and processed foods. Replacing saturated fat with unsaturated fat — olive oil, avocado, nuts, fatty fish — consistently lowers LDL in clinical studies.
Soluble fiber is another powerful lever. It binds to cholesterol in the digestive tract and removes it before it enters circulation. Oats, barley, beans, lentils, apples, and citrus are all good sources. Aiming for 10–25 grams of soluble fiber daily can produce meaningful LDL reductions.
High blood pressure
Sodium is the most direct dietary driver of blood pressure. The American Heart Association recommends under 2,300mg per day — most Americans consume significantly more, largely from processed and restaurant foods. Reading labels matters more than avoiding the salt shaker.
The DASH diet (Dietary Approaches to Stop Hypertension) is the most evidence-backed eating pattern for blood pressure reduction. It emphasizes vegetables, fruits, whole grains, low-fat dairy, and lean proteins while limiting sodium, red meat, and added sugars. In clinical trials, it reduces systolic blood pressure by an average of 5–11 mmHg — comparable to some medications.
Potassium, magnesium, and calcium also play a role in blood pressure regulation. These are found in leafy greens, legumes, nuts, seeds, and dairy.
The problem with managing multiple conditions at once
Most patients with one abnormal lab value have others. Elevated A1c often comes with high triglycerides. High LDL frequently accompanies high blood pressure. Prediabetes and high cholesterol frequently travel together.
The challenge — and this is something the pamphlets never address — is that the optimal diet for each condition overlaps significantly but isn't identical. A very low-carbohydrate diet may help A1c but can raise LDL in some patients. A low-fat approach that helps cholesterol may not adequately address blood sugar if it's high in refined carbohydrates.
Getting the balance right across multiple diagnoses requires knowing your specific numbers and applying guidelines that account for all of them simultaneously. That's not something a general internet search can do for you.
A practical starting framework
While your plan should ultimately be personalized to your specific labs and diagnoses, here are the evidence-based principles that apply broadly across the most common abnormal lab values:
1. Make fiber the centerpiece of every meal. Fiber slows glucose absorption, feeds beneficial gut bacteria, reduces LDL, and helps with satiety. Fill half your plate with non-starchy vegetables at lunch and dinner. Add legumes — beans, lentils, chickpeas — as often as possible.
2. Replace refined grains with whole grains. Swap white rice for brown rice or farro. White bread for whole grain bread with visible seeds. Standard pasta for legume-based pasta or whole wheat. This single swap has measurable effects on both blood sugar and cholesterol.
3. Choose your proteins carefully. Fatty fish (salmon, mackerel, sardines) two to three times per week supports both heart health and reduces inflammation. Chicken and turkey without skin, legumes, and low-fat dairy are good everyday options. Limit red meat to once or twice a week, and avoid processed meats — deli meats, sausage, bacon — as much as possible.
4. Use olive oil as your primary cooking fat. Replacing butter and vegetable shortening with extra-virgin olive oil consistently improves lipid panels. It doesn't need to be expensive — any extra-virgin olive oil works.
5. Read sodium labels, not just the salt shaker. Most dietary sodium comes from packaged and restaurant food, not what you add at the table. Soups, deli meats, condiments, bread, and frozen meals are often high-sodium in ways that aren't obvious. Look for items under 140mg sodium per serving.
6. Distribute carbohydrates across the day. Rather than having most of your carbohydrates at one meal, spread them out. A large carbohydrate load at dinner is harder on blood sugar than the same amount spread across breakfast, lunch, and dinner.
What a dietitian would tell you that a pamphlet can't
A registered dietitian does something that no article can fully replicate: they sit with you, understand your food preferences, your schedule, your cultural background, your cooking skills, and your budget — and they build a plan that fits your actual life.
The most nutritionally perfect meal plan in the world doesn't work if the patient won't follow it. Adherence is the variable that matters most, and adherence depends on the plan feeling realistic and sustainable.
If your physician refers you to a registered dietitian, take that referral seriously. The evidence for medical nutrition therapy — structured dietary counseling with a credentialed professional — is strong across diabetes, cardiovascular disease, and chronic kidney disease.

Your lab values are not a verdict. They're data. And unlike most data points in medicine, they're highly responsive to what you eat. A1c can drop meaningfully in three months with consistent dietary changes. LDL responds to dietary fat modification within weeks. Blood pressure responds to sodium reduction and the DASH pattern within days to weeks.
The challenge isn't knowing that diet matters — most people already know that. The challenge is knowing specifically what to eat, given your specific numbers, in a way that's realistic for your life.
